The Beauty of Natural Dye
One of the most delightful things about natural dye is that its color can be wonderfully unexpected.
Avocado creates a surprisingly beautiful family of soft pinks and muted rose tones. Rather than the bright, uniform pink of commercially colored paper, these sheets have a quieter botanical quality—dusty, softly aged, and naturally varied.
No two batches—and no two sheets—are exactly alike.
One area may develop a slightly deeper rose tone while another remains delicately blush. You may find subtle mottling, speckles, organic markings, impressions, or gentle shifts in color across a single sheet.
The drying process can leave its own marks as well. Paper may pick up impressions from cloth, paper towels, textured surfaces, or other materials it encounters during the process.
Some sheets are deliberately patterned using stencils. Others are left to reveal whatever patterns the avocado dye and drying process create on their own.
These variations aren't imperfections to be removed.
They're part of what natural dye made.
And because nature doesn't repeat herself precisely, there is no “standard” 10-sheet package.

Care & Storage
Because these papers receive their color from natural materials rather than commercially manufactured colorfast dyes, some change in color may occur over time.
For best preservation, store unused papers in a cool, dry location away from prolonged direct sunlight, excessive moisture, and humidity.
Natural dyes may react differently with adhesives, sealants, sprays, inks, wet media, and other art materials. If the finished appearance is important to your project, testing your chosen product on a scrap or inconspicuous area first is recommended.
These papers are intended for decorative paper crafting and creative use.
They are not represented as archival, acid-free, food-safe, or colorfast unless specifically stated otherwise.
